Default Amazon.com Gift Card expiration?

[ QUOTE ]
* Expiration dates do not apply in California, Connecticut, Maine, Montana, Rhode Island, and Washington. Expiration date applies in New Hampshire only for gift certificates more than $100. For the following states, a gift certificate will expire after the indicated period of time as measured from the date of issuance: Louisiana (5 years), Maryland (4 years), Massachusetts (7 years), North Dakota (6 years), Oklahoma (5 years), and Vermont (3 years). Expiration dates do not apply in any other states solely to the extent as prohibited or limited by law.

[/ QUOTE ]

I currently live in Massachusetts. If PokerStars issues me a bunch of $500 gift certificates, will they be good for seven years? What if I move to New York? If I move to Washington will they be good forever?
